The Magic of Time Zones
Now, here's the kicker: Alaska Time is three hours behind Eastern Time.
QuickTip: Copy useful snippets to a notes app.
So, when it's 5 PM in the vibrant, neon-lit streets of NYC, it's a leisurely 2 PM in the majestic, glacier-strewn landscapes of Anchorage.

How to schedule a call with someone in NYC if you're in Anchorage?
- Quick Answer: Add three hours to your local time in Anchorage to determine the time in NYC.
